At 79, She's Setting New Standards for Senior Fitness

SINGAPORE – Dr. Charlotte Lim may stand just 1.58 m tall and weigh 49 kg, but she’s lifting heavier than many could imagine. This 79-year-old powerhouse not only tackles her own body weight, but also impresses with her barbell back squats at 50 kg and an astonishing endurance for dead-hangs lasting over 3.5 minutes.

A Gym Journey That Inspires Generations

Dr. Lim began her fitness journey at 72, joining the family-run Bespoke Fitness gym, encouraged by her health-focused children, Yan Lin and Tiat Lim. What started as a quest for family bonding turned into a remarkable transformation. Just a few years ago, she struggled with basic exercises like sit-ups; now she crushes up to 100 pull-ups in a single session.

From 'Skinny Fat' to 'Jacked'

Once classified as 'skinny fat' with a body fat percentage of 29%, Dr. Lim now boasts just 15%. Her dedication to the FitRX training program three times a week has revolutionized her health, helping her dodge common age-related ailments such as sarcopenia, which leads to muscle loss in the elderly.

She's Winning Races and Hearts!

In July, Dr. Lim proudly took home the gold in the 100m dash for the 75-79 age category at the Singapore Masters Track and Field Championships, finishing ahead of a 78-year-old competitor. Such feats have garnered her a social media following, with the @pullup_grandma Instagram account attracting over 1,830 supporters.

Redefining Senior Fitness Culture

Dr. Lim represents a growing trend in Singapore's super-ageing society, where more seniors are actively engaging in strength training to combat age-related health issues. The shift reflects changing societal norms around aging, with one in four Singaporeans projected to be 65 and older by 2030.

Innovative Gyms Cater to the Senior Demographic

As fitness health consciousness rises among older adults, many gyms, like Gym Tonic and Aspire55, are specifically designed to accommodate seniors. These spaces not only focus on physical fitness but foster social interactions, creating communities where age is just a number.

Empowering Changes for Healthier Lives

With initiatives like Healthier SG focusing on promoting fitness among older adults, a new era of senior fitness is emerging. Programs that previously required parental encouragement now see seniors signing up independently, with a growing understanding that frailty can be delayed or even reversed.
